
Salem County Historical Society
The Salem County Historical Society consists of four interconnected historic buildings dating from c.1700 to c.1800, the center-piece of which is the Alexander Grant’s Mansion House (1721) and the Josephine Jaquett Memorial Library. The Society contains a collection of over 10,000 historic objects, and a variety of exhibitions to tour. In addition, visitors may also conduct research in their research library, containing books, historic documents, photographs and more.
